Output 83eecfceae56d5b23a92496eccd5915b206808acaa2e9d703d762d0723f8b424:1

value
595528125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26231bd9e4104d8cc82a09a28afb115b08dc6444 OP_EQUAL
address
MBNoy7zvFVkyHSpV2o7CGm8QSG1B82iAKD
transaction
83eecfceae56d5b23a92496eccd5915b206808acaa2e9d703d762d0723f8b424
spent
true